This FDA Food action (record #F-0626-2025) was formally reported on March 19, 2025, with the manufacturer initiating the action on February 21, 2025. It is classified under Moderate severity (Class II), with a current status of Ongoing. Danone Wave is listed as the recalling firm, operating out of Louisville, CO. Federal records list the affected scope as 4,762cs/6/32 fl oz bottles.
The documented reason for this recall is: The firm received complaints of spoilage and illness with the use of the products. Distribution data in the federal record shows the product reached: The product was shipped to the following states: AL, AR, CO, CT, FL, GA, IL, IN, KY, LA, MD, ME, MI, MN, MO, MS, NC, NE, NH, NJ, NM, NY, OH, OK, PA, SC, TN, TX, VA, WI & WY..
